Officer found not guilty in Freddie Gray case
Nero acquitted of four charges related to case that sparked protests
A Baltimore policeman has been found not guilty on all criminal charges in the Freddie Gray case, whose death last year in police custody sparked riots in the city.
Officer Edward Nero was found not guilty on all four charges in the death of Gray, an African-American who was 25 years old at the time of death. Nero, who is white, was the second of six officers to face trial on charges related to Gray’s death.
Gray’s death fueled African-Americans’ distrust toward police officers and triggered violent protests. Of the six officers charged in the case, three are white and three are black. The trial of the first officer ended in a hung jury.
Nero was charged with second-degree assault, reckless endangerment and two counts of misconduct in office.
